Know the problem with your watch. There are many professionals around who can repair different timepieces, depending on the nature of the problem. There are some who can only deal with less technical aspects such as engraving and restringing beaded jewelry.
Confirm that the expert has specialized training on that particular brand. Common models normally have no problem, as there are many experts who can deal with them. Unfortunately, for a retro watch, it may be a different matter altogether as there are few individuals trained on their features and functions. Therefore, make sure the professionals can take care of the particular issue, regardless of whether it is crown and stem replacement, movement-servicing, crystal replacement, link removal, band restoration, band and case refinishing, or gasket replacement.
Traditionally, watchmakers were required to undergo a minimum of seven years of training. However, nowadays, training programs can take as little as three weeks depending on the particular program. However, if you want someone reliable, ensure that the individual has received not less than three years of training in an accredited school.
Choose an expert with a Master Watchmaker Certificate. In case you are searching particularly for an individual competent in mechanical wristwatches, be sure that he or she has this important qualification. Their main focus is usually upon components like the movements, functioning of chronographs, and hairsprings. An AWCI certified professional can restore mechanical parts as well as replacing quartz crystals.
Take into account the charges. Classical timepieces are normally very costly to repair since the tools essential for the task are usually very costly. Each individual will charge differently based on the damaged part and the accessibility to replacement parts. Nevertheless, you can consider at least four different experts to help you have more knowledge on the charges.
Check the practical experience of the professional. It requires several years to perfectly understand the features of some watches. Somebody who has been doing the business of fixing damaged timepieces for several decades certainly would offer more compared to a novice. However, never overlook someone for lack of practical experience while not evaluating him or her first.
Pick an associate of a trade organization, for example, the American Watchmakers-Clockmakers Institute. It ensures that the associates are extremely skilled and knowledgeable enough to provide exceptional and professional services. They also advise wristwatch owners on maintenance.
